Amar’e to Make New Year’s Day Debut?

Could Amar’e Stoudemire make his season debut with the Knicks on January 1?

In an interview with ESPN’s Heather Cox on Tuesday, Stoudemire acknowledged that the Blazers game on Jan. 1 could be a target for his return, if his rehabilitation continues without impediment.

The Knicks had hoped Stoudemire would return sometime during their three-game road trip from Dec. 25-28.

But that appears unlikely.

Mike Woodson would prefer Stoudemire to have some practice time with his teammates. Last week, Stoudemire practiced with the Knicks’ D League team, the Erie BayHawks, because the Knicks did not hold practice due to a condensed schedule.
